Originally Posted by Murray
I carry a large see-through plastic bag. When it rains, I slip the scorepad inside and can score without removing it from the bag. Works a treat.

Another tip is to buy fisher space pen refills - they come with an adapter which allows them to fit any pen which takes a parker style refill. These write on wet target faces, upside down, you name it.
